Was Vehicle Towed: - Description of the Complaints: I am a professional driver with over 1 mil acident free miles. every year the headlights get aimed worse, the technology gets brighter and sometimes wider dispersion (blinding) and more drivers drive fulltime with fog lights (non-lenticular lens). manufacturers are encouraging this process with the manufacture of autos with big fog lights and failing to label them with restrictive use warnings. in addition, their advertising always shows vehicles with these lights on in their advertisments. because of the severity i am forced to block out their lights (at the rate of about one in twenty-five) with my hand, and therefore will have no opportunity to avoid an accident if they cross the center line since i cannot see them. police in every state must be told to enforce existing laws against full-time fog lights and must regulate the brightness and aim of headlights. the problem has become epidemic.
